Painter Tool Box with Vertical Brush Holder and Segmented Compartments
Find Innovative SolutionsGenerate Solutions
Solution Overview
Problem
Existing tool boxes for painters do not efficiently transport multiple tools and paints, including paint brushes and rollers, especially when they are wet, and lack adjustable compartments to accommodate varying quantities of supplies.
Innovation Solution
A tool box with multiple receiving spaces, a handle for transport, and a mechanism to hold paint brushes or rollers vertically, featuring removable rods or bars that can be positioned through tool handles to prevent contamination and facilitate drying, with adjustable compartments to accommodate different quantities of tools and paints.

2Object-affected harmful factors
If paint brushes and rollers are transported horizontally, then they are easy to access, but wet tools cause cross-contamination and drying issues
Solution Approach 1:
The invention transitions tool storage from a horizontal arrangement to a vertical orientation within the compartment. Paint brushes and rollers are positioned upright in vertical slots or against vertical walls, which prevents the bristles/rollers from touching each other and causing cross-contamination, while also allowing excess paint to drain properly without pooling.
Solution Approach 2:
Vertical dividers or walls act as intermediaries between different painting tools, physically separating them to prevent cross-contamination. These structural elements mediate between the need for tool storage and the need to prevent paint transfer between tools.

The invention provides an improved tool box useful for painters featuring a first receiving space or compartment, a second receiving space or compartment, a handle or means for carrying or transporting the tool box, and a means for receiving or holding in a substantially vertical position a paint brush or paint roller or tool useful for a painter. The tool box may be formed of any suitable material or combination or materials such as wood, fiber board, pressboard, rubber, plastic, metal or cardboard. The tool box may be designed for extended life or it may be formed of one or more materials adapted to be disposed of after one or a few or several uses. The tool box may be of any suitable shape such as substantially rectangular, square, oblong, elliptical, round, etc.
